Financial Incentives to Encourage Value-Based Health Care

A Scott, M Liu, J Yong

Medical Care Research and Review | SAGE PUBLICATIONS INC | Published : 2018

Abstract

This article reviews the literature on the use of financial incentives to improve the provision of value-based health care. Eighty studies of 44 schemes from 10 countries were reviewed. The proportion of positive and statistically significant outcomes was close to.5. Stronger study designs were associated with a lower proportion of positive effects. There were no differences between studies conducted in the United States compared with other countries; between schemes that targeted hospitals or primary care; or between schemes combining pay for performance with rewards for reducing costs, relative to pay for performance schemes alone.
